A kitchen remodel is one of the most rewarding home improvement projects you can undertake. Not only does it enhance the aesthetic appeal of your home, but it also increases its functionality and value. However, embarking on a kitchen remodel can be overwhelming without proper planning and guidance. In this article, we’ll explore essential tips and considerations to help you achieve a successful kitchen remodel.

  1. Set Clear Goals: Before diving into your kitchen remodel, take some time to define your goals. Ask yourself what you hope to achieve with the remodel. Are you looking to update outdated fixtures and appliances, improve functionality, increase storage space, or enhance the overall aesthetic appeal? Clearly defining your objectives will guide the entire remodeling process and ensure that the end result meets your expectations.
  2. Establish a Realistic Budget: Setting a realistic budget is crucial for any remodeling project. Determine how much you’re willing to spend on your kitchen remodel and allocate funds accordingly. Remember to factor in costs for materials, labor, permits, and unexpected expenses. It’s also a good idea to set aside a contingency fund to cover any unforeseen issues that may arise during the renovation process.
  3. Research Design Trends and Inspiration: Browse through home design magazines, websites, and social media platforms to gather inspiration for your kitchen remodel. Pay attention to current design trends, color schemes, and innovative storage solutions. Take note of features and elements that appeal to you and consider incorporating them into your own kitchen design. Additionally, consult with design professionals or visit showrooms to explore different options and gather ideas.
  4. Focus on Functionality: When redesigning your kitchen, prioritize functionality to create a space that is efficient and practical for everyday use. Consider the layout of your kitchen and how it can be optimized to improve workflow and accessibility. Think about factors such as the placement of appliances, storage solutions, countertop space, and traffic flow. A well-designed kitchen should not only look beautiful but also be highly functional and user-friendly.
  5. Choose Quality Materials and Appliances: Invest in high-quality materials and appliances that will stand the test of time. Opt for durable, low-maintenance materials for countertops, flooring, and cabinetry that can withstand the rigors of daily use. When selecting appliances, prioritize energy efficiency, performance, and features that align with your cooking needs and lifestyle. Remember that quality materials and appliances may come with a higher upfront cost, but they will ultimately save you money in the long run by lasting longer and requiring fewer repairs or replacements.
  6. Hire Reliable Professionals: Unless you’re a seasoned DIY enthusiast with experience in kitchen remodeling, it’s advisable to hire professional contractors and tradespeople to oversee the project. Look for reputable contractors with a proven track record of delivering high-quality workmanship and excellent customer service. Obtain multiple quotes, check references, and verify credentials before making your final decision. A skilled and experienced team will ensure that your kitchen remodel is completed efficiently, safely, and to your satisfaction.
  7. Plan for Disruption: Remodeling your kitchen can disrupt your daily routine, so it’s essential to plan accordingly. Set up a temporary kitchen area elsewhere in your home where you can prepare meals and wash dishes during the renovation process. Communicate with your contractor to establish a timeline for the project and minimize disruptions as much as possible. Be prepared for some inconvenience and mess, but keep your eyes on the prize – a beautiful new kitchen that will be well worth the temporary inconvenience.
